HIPPIE ERA DRUG ADDICTION & ABUSE EDUCATIONAL FILM

Documentary

Rating:9/10 (1)

This experimental 1970 color documentary film, ostensibly designed to provoke classroom discussion employs a boldly unconventional approach to addressing the issues of drug addiction, featuring the music of Canadian singer-songwriter Bruce Cockburn. The film eschews narration for montage effects and extended fly-on-the-wall scenes of various drug users in conversation.
